Output 86111755cc75b4de1e4c671105b90f2a1151687ab869e0e9cd214dc1cd9d0e55:1784

value
25206
script pubkey
OP_0 OP_PUSHBYTES_20 8f02f126a84968e45251ef45865bf18b050cf49f
address
ltc1q3up0zf4gf95wg5j3aazcvkl33vzseaylzm4zw2
transaction
86111755cc75b4de1e4c671105b90f2a1151687ab869e0e9cd214dc1cd9d0e55
spent
false